Nota di contenuto: 1 John Winthrop and Nova Scotia, 1630-1649 -- 2 Robert Sedgwick, Thomas Temple, and Nova Scotia, 1650-1670 -- 3 Years of Peace and Years of Growing Tension, 1670-1686 -- 4 John Nelson, William Phips, and the Capture of Nova Scotia, 1687-1690 - 5 John Nelson and Benjamin Church, 1690-1697 -- 6 Joseph Dudley, 1698-1707 -- 7 Samuel Vetch and Francis Nicholson, 1708-1717 -- 8 Massachusetts, Canso, Annapolis Royal, and Louisbourg, 1718-1744 -- 9 William Shirley and Louisbourg, 1744- 1745 -- 10 The Capture of Louisbourg and Aftermath, 1745- 1748 -- 11 William Shirley and Charles Lawrence, 1749-1756 -- 12 Massachusetts and Nova Scotia, 1757-1776 -- 13 Privateering and Revival: The Revolutionary Years, 1777-1784.
Sommario/riassunto: This book is primarily concerned with describing and attempting to account for, first, the continuing economic hammerlock Massachusetts had during most of the period from 1630 to 1784 over the neighbouring colony and, second, the various military thrusts sent from New England to the region to the northeast.
